Job Description
|
|
Chief Ultrasound Technologist
|
|
May perform duties of Ultrasound Technologist. Oversees Ultrasound Technologists and maintains the technical aspects of ultrasound services. Acts as a liaison between technologists, physicians and area support staff. Suggests equipment modification and evaluates accuracy and quality of ultrasound images. Requires a two year allied health degree, successful completion of an approved one-year program in Ultrasound Technology, and at least 7 years of experience in the field. May require registration with the American Registry of Diagnostic Medical Sonographers (ARDMS). Familiar with a variety of the field's concepts, practices, and procedures. Relies on extensive experience and judgment to plan and accomplish goals. Performs a variety of tasks. Leads and directs the work of others. A wide degree of creativity and latitude is expected. Typically reports to a manager or director.
